Moon Lake Electric Assn Inc · Colorado

Cooperative utility · EIA utility no. 12866 · 1,526 residential customers reported

In 2024, Moon Lake Electric Assn Inc's Colorado customers averaged 1.8 outages and 466 minutes without power, and paid about $79 a month for electricity (9.4¢/kWh). These are Moon Lake Electric Assn Inc's own filings to EIA, under the Other reliability standard, including major storm days.

Outage history

Minutes without power per customer · storm days shown separately
Moon Lake Electric Assn Inc annual outage history in Colorado: minutes without power per customer with and without major storm days, and outages per year, by year, from EIA.
Year With storm days Without storm days Outages / yr Relative duration
2024 466 466 1.8
2023 122 122 2.2
2022 153 153 1.9
2021 1,715 1,715 4.6
2020 959 206 1.8
2019 378 378 1.1
2018 225 225 0.9
2017 18 18 0.1
2016 103 103 0.7
2015 149 138 1.3
Storm-heavy years look worse with major storm days included; with them removed, the underlying year is comparable. We always show both so a single storm season is not mistaken for a trend. What is a Major Event Day?

Self-reported
Utilities report these figures to EIA themselves; EIA does not audit every submission, and outages from recent months appear only in the next annual release.

Reporting standard
Moon Lake Electric Assn Inc reports under the utility-defined (non-IEEE) method. The standard used is shown so figures are not mixed silently.
Counties served
Garfield, Moffat, Rio Blanco.
